Anti-government religious foundation’s Ankara offices sealed over alleged illegal activities - Turkish Minute
Turkish authorities have sealed the #Ankara headquarters and three local offices of the anti-government Furkan Foundation, a religious group, over allegations of operating unauthorized social facilities.
The Ankara Governorate's Provincial Directorate of Associations sealed the headquarters and three representative offices of the Furkan Education and Research Association, affiliated with the Furkan Foundation, founded by Alparslan Kuytul, on the grounds of "conducting unauthorized local activities."
